Join us for a dynamic, hands-on workshop designed for both general and special education teachers working in inclusion and resource settings.

Teaching in Tandem offers practical tools and strategies to support all learners because every teacher works with students who have a wide variety of needs. 

This session will explore high-leverage teaching practices and provide an overview of Universal Design for Learning (UDL) and co-teaching models to create a deeper understanding of how to implement explicit instruction effectively to bridge the gap of student achievement and grade level expectations. Participants will walk away with a ready-to-use teaching toolbox filled with free resources tailored for inclusion and small group settings.

Whether you’re a classroom veteran or looking to refine your strategies for reaching students with different learning needs, this workshop is for you.
